What Is Australia Post and How Does It Work?

Australia post is a government-owned postal service that delivers letters and parcels across Australia and around the world. It started many years ago to connect people through mail, but today it also supports eCommerce and online shopping. When you send something through Australia post, it gets sorted at a mail center and then delivered by posties or parcel drivers.

You can post letters by dropping them in red post boxes, or you can visit a post office to send bigger packages. The system is well-organized and uses advanced tracking, so you always know where your mail is. With Australia post, you don’t need to worry — your mail is in safe hands.

Services You Can Use at Australia Post

Australia post offers a range of services for both personal and business use. You can:

  • Send local and international letters or parcels.
  • Track deliveries in real-time online.
  • Pay bills through the Post Billpay service.
  • Get passport photos and applications.
  • Buy prepaid cards, gift cards, or travel money cards.
  • Rent a P.O. Box for secure mail delivery.

It’s a one-stop shop that helps with both mailing and everyday needs. Many people also use Australia post for online shopping returns, which makes it very handy for busy shoppers.

How to Track Your Parcel with Australia Post

Tracking your parcel is one of the most useful tools from Australia post. When you send or receive a parcel, you get a tracking number. You can enter this number on the Australia post website or app to see where your item is.

The tracker shows updates like when the parcel was sent, when it reached the sorting center, and when it’s out for delivery. This feature helps you stay calm, knowing your package is on its way. You can even get email or text updates about your delivery status.

Sending Mail and Packages Safely with Australia Post

When sending something important, safety is key. Australia post gives you packaging options like padded bags, boxes, and express satchels to keep your items protected. You can also add extra services like signature on delivery or insurance for valuable items.

For international deliveries, Australia post checks customs rules to make sure your parcel reaches the right country without trouble. If you follow their packaging and labeling guidelines, your items are more likely to arrive safely and on time.

Australia Post Delivery Times and Costs Explained

Delivery time depends on where you are sending your parcel. Local deliveries usually take 1–3 business days, while interstate parcels might take a bit longer. Express Post is a faster option if you want your parcel delivered quickly — sometimes even the next day.

Costs depend on weight, size, and destination. Australia post has online calculators where you can check postage prices easily. This helps you plan your budget before sending anything.

Australia Post Office Locations and Opening Hours

There are thousands of Australia post offices across the country. You can find one in most suburbs and towns. Many are open Monday to Friday, and some also open on Saturdays for short hours.

You can use the Australia post website or app to find the nearest post office, its hours, and what services it offers. Some larger offices also have self-service machines for quick posting and parcel collection, even outside normal hours.
